Two charges placed in air repel each other by a force of 10⁻⁴ N. When oil is introduced between the charges, the force becomes 2.5 x 10⁻⁵ N. The dielectric constant of oil is
Options
(a) 2.5
(b) 0.25
(c) 2
(d) 4
Correct Answer:
4
